About This File
This 3D model of larynx and pharynx disorders provides a detailed and anatomically accurate representation of the human larynx and pharynx, highlighting common structural abnormalities and conditions. The model showcases key features, including the vocal cords, epiglottis, pharyngeal wall, and surrounding tissues, while demonstrating disorders such as vocal cord nodules, polyps, pharyngitis, and laryngitis. It also provides insights into conditions affecting swallowing and breathing, such as tumors, cysts, or inflammation.
